Day-to-Day Responsibilities
  • Design mechanical HVAC systems for a variety of building types, from concept through construction documents
  • Coordinate closely with architectural and engineering departments to produce integrated, well-coordinated drawing packages
  • Manage project schedules and deliverables, ensuring timely completion aligned with overall project milestones
  • Assist with construction administration activities, including responding to RFIs, reviewing submittals, conducting site visits, and preparing observation reports
  • Communicate effectively with internal project teams, clients, and contractors throughout the project lifecycle
  • Participate in ongoing professional development activities, including internal training sessions and continuing education opportunities
  • Support senior engineers and project leads with technical calculations, system selections, and equipment specifications as needed Required Skills & Qualifications
  • Bachelor's degree in Mechanical Engineering, Architectural Engineering, or a closely related field (preferred; strong candidates without a degree will be considered)
  • 0-5 years of experience in HVAC system design or mechanical engineering within an architectural or engineering firm; recent graduates are encouraged to apply
  • Familiarity with HVAC system design principles, load calculations, and equipment selection
  • formal experience helpful but not required for motivated candidates
  • Proficiency or willingness to learn industry-standard design and drafting software (AutoCAD, Revit MEP, or similar)
  • Strong analytical mindset with attention to detail and the ability to produce accurate, coordinated technical drawings
  • Excellent verbal and written communication skills; comfortable working in a team-oriented, multi-discipline environment
  • Self-starter with a strong work ethic and a genuine drive to grow professionally
  • EIT certification (or progress toward PE licensure) is a plus, but not required Why This Role Stands Out
